在数字化时代,移动应用已经成为人们日常生活中不可或缺的一部分。一个直观、易用的菜单设计对于提升用户体验至关重要。iApp菜单源码作为一款流行的移动应用导航组件,其灵活性和定制性受到了开发者的青睐。本文将揭秘如何轻松掌握iApp菜单源码,并打造出个性化的移动应用导航。
一、了解iApp菜单源码
1.1 iApp菜单源码简介
iApp菜单源码是一款开源的移动应用导航组件,支持iOS和Android平台。它具有丰富的功能,如侧滑菜单、底部导航栏、顶部工具栏等,可以帮助开发者快速搭建出美观、实用的导航界面。
1.2 iApp菜单源码的优势
- 跨平台支持:适用于iOS和Android平台,方便开发者统一开发、部署。
- 高度定制:支持自定义样式、颜色、字体等,满足个性化需求。
- 易于集成:提供详细的文档和示例代码,方便开发者快速上手。
二、掌握iApp菜单源码
2.1 环境搭建
在开始之前,确保你的开发环境已经搭建好,包括Xcode(iOS)和Android Studio(Android)。同时,安装好相应的开发工具,如Swift(iOS)和Kotlin(Android)。
2.2 下载iApp菜单源码
访问iApp菜单源码的GitHub页面,下载最新版本的源码。解压后,将源码导入到你的开发项目中。
2.3 集成iApp菜单
以下以iOS平台为例,介绍如何将iApp菜单集成到你的项目中。
import UIKit
import iAppMenu
class ViewController: UIViewController {
override func viewDidLoad() {
super.viewDidLoad()
// 创建iApp菜单
let menu = iAppMenu(frame: self.view.bounds)
menu.backgroundColor = UIColor.white
self.view.addSubview(menu)
// 添加菜单项
let item1 = iAppMenuItem(title: "首页", icon: UIImage(named: "home_icon"))
let item2 = iAppMenuItem(title: "消息", icon: UIImage(named: "message_icon"))
menu.addItem(item1)
menu.addItem(item2)
// 设置菜单点击事件
menu.itemTapHandler = { (item) in
print("点击了\(item.title)菜单项")
}
}
}
2.4 调整样式
根据需求,你可以对iApp菜单的样式进行调整,如修改背景颜色、字体、图标等。
menu.backgroundColor = UIColor.red
menu.font = UIFont.systemFont(ofSize: 16, weight: .bold)
menu.iconSize = CGSize(width: 24, height: 24)
三、打造个性化移动应用导航
3.1 分析用户需求
在打造个性化移动应用导航之前,首先要了解用户的需求。可以通过问卷调查、用户访谈等方式收集用户反馈,了解他们对导航的需求。
3.2 设计导航结构
根据用户需求,设计合理的导航结构。例如,可以将导航分为首页、消息、我的等模块,每个模块下再细分功能。
3.3 定制导航样式
根据设计稿,对iApp菜单进行样式定制。可以调整背景颜色、字体、图标等,使导航界面与整体风格保持一致。
3.4 优化用户体验
在打造个性化移动应用导航的过程中,要注重用户体验。例如,可以优化菜单的交互效果,使操作更加流畅;提供搜索功能,方便用户快速找到所需内容。
四、总结
通过本文的介绍,相信你已经掌握了如何轻松掌握iApp菜单源码,并打造出个性化的移动应用导航。在实际开发过程中,不断优化和调整,让你的应用导航更加美观、实用,提升用户体验。
